Amana Living is seeking a enthusiastic and organised Learning Coordinator to join our Learning & Organisational Development (L&OD) team. This vital role supports the coordination and administration of internal staff training programs, aligning with our strategic development plan andreinforcing organisation values and helping drive achievement of Amana Livings vision and mission.
What You’ll Be Doing: As our Learning Coordinator, you’ll play a key role in shaping the professional development experience across Amana Living. Your responsibilities will include:
- **Coordinating Training Programs**: Oversee end-to-end coordination of staff learning activities including mandatory compliance training, induction programs, professional development, and online modules. This includes managing calendars, liaising with trainers, securing venues, preparing materials, and ensuring smooth day-of delivery.
- **Maintaining Accurate Training Records**: Update and maintain training data in systems like Chris21, ensuring all employee records are accurate and current. Generate detailed reports and dashboards to support compliance, insights, and planning.
- **Collaborating with Stakeholders**: Partner closely with the Clinical Learning Coordinator, L&OD team, People & Culture, ALTI, and other internal stakeholders to ensure alignment on training needs, priorities, and best practices. Actively participate in planning conversations and feedback loops.
- **Digital Learning Administration**: Manage access to eLearning platforms and content by setting up users, assigning training modules, tracking completion, and assisting with technical queries. Ensure the online learning environment is well-maintained, accessible, and aligned with learning objectives.
- **Continuous Improvement & Compliance**: Monitor and evaluate training programs, resources, and learning outcomes. Identify improvement opportunities and collaborate on updating materials, processes, or delivery formats to enhance engagement and effectiveness.
- **Event & Logistics Coordination**: Organise training sessions and events, including bookings, catering, resource allocation, and managing inventory of training equipment. Raise purchase orders and process invoices using systems like Epicor ARM.
- **Monitoring & Reporting**: Provide regular reports to the Manager, Learning & Organisational Development, including progress updates, completion statistics, and risk areas for non-compliance. Help monitor mandatory training completion across the organisation.

Amana Living is one of the largest Aged Care providers in Western Australia and has been responding to the needs of older people and those who care for them since 1962. We offer a broad range of services, including residential care homes, transition care programs, retirement living villages, home care, day care, respite, and dementia specific services.
